Datalife Engine 14.0
- Temalara yeni taglar eklendi ve geliştirildi
- Yeni AirPlay medya oynatıcısı eklendi
- 1500 adet yeni ifade (emoji) eklendi
Periyodik olarak gösterilecek PopUp eklentisi
Bu eklenti ile kullanıcılarınıza belirli vakit aralıklarında popup gösterebilirsiniz
İlk olarak gereken javascript kütüphanelerini indiriyoruz.
1) https://github.com/js-cookie/js-cookie ( Dosya yolu: /src/js.cookie.js )
2) https://github.com/vodkabears/Remodal ( Dosya yolları: /dist/remodal-default-theme.css, /dist/remodal.min.js, /dist/remodal.css )
CSS dosyalarını temanızdaki css lerin bulunduğu ( /css ) klasöre, JS dosyalarını da aynı şekilde js dosyalarının bulunduğu ( /js ) klasöre atın.
Temanızın main.tpl dosyasını açarak css ve js dosyalarını aşağıdaki örnekteki gibi ekleyin. ( css leri head içine, js leri body kapanışından öncesine ekleyin )
Koddaki expires: 1 demek günde 1 kez demek, yani ikinci gösterimi ilk gösterimden 1 gün sonra olacaktır. 1500 ise sayfa açıldıktan 1,5 saniye sonra popup açılacak demektir.
Bu HTML kod, eklenen javascript dosyalarından daha yukarı eklenmelidir. Başlığı ve içeriği kendizine göre düzenleyin.
İlk olarak gereken javascript kütüphanelerini indiriyoruz.
1) https://github.com/js-cookie/js-cookie ( Dosya yolu: /src/js.cookie.js )
2) https://github.com/vodkabears/Remodal ( Dosya yolları: /dist/remodal-default-theme.css, /dist/remodal.min.js, /dist/remodal.css )
CSS dosyalarını temanızdaki css lerin bulunduğu ( /css ) klasöre, JS dosyalarını da aynı şekilde js dosyalarının bulunduğu ( /js ) klasöre atın.
Temanızın main.tpl dosyasını açarak css ve js dosyalarını aşağıdaki örnekteki gibi ekleyin. ( css leri head içine, js leri body kapanışından öncesine ekleyin )
<link href="{THEME}/css/remodal.css" type="text/css" rel="stylesheet">
<link href="{THEME}/css/remodal-default-theme.css" type="text/css" rel="stylesheet">
<script src="{THEME}/js/js.cookie.js"></script>
<script src="{THEME}/js/remodal.min.js"></script>
<script type="text/javascript">
if ( ! Cookies.get('duyuru') ) {
var duyuru = $('#duyuru').remodal();
setTimeout( function() {
Cookies.set('duyuru', '1', { expires: 1 });
duyuru.open();
}, 1500 );
}
</script>
Koddaki expires: 1 demek günde 1 kez demek, yani ikinci gösterimi ilk gösterimden 1 gün sonra olacaktır. 1500 ise sayfa açıldıktan 1,5 saniye sonra popup açılacak demektir.
Bu HTML kod, eklenen javascript dosyalarından daha yukarı eklenmelidir. Başlığı ve içeriği kendizine göre düzenleyin.
<div data-remodal-id="duyuru" role="dialog" aria-labelledby="modal2Title" aria-describedby="modal2Desc">
<div>
<h2 id="modal2Title">Pencere Başlığı</h2>
<p id="modal2Desc">
Açıklamalar buraya
</p>
</div>
<button data-remodal-action="confirm" class="remodal-confirm">Tamam</button>
</div>
Bilgilendirme
Yorum Ekleyebilmeniz için Sitemize Kayıt Olmanız Gerekmektedir.